S200 PBT is a 2008 Honda S2000 in Grey with a 1,997c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 93.8%.

Across all 2008 Honda S2000 models, the average MOT pass rate is 86.8% with a typical mileage of 40,687 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Honda S2000 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 6,528 recorded failures. If you're considering buying S200 PBT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Honda S2000 typ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 18 years old, this Honda S2000 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
